首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 其他教程 > 其他相关 >

zeroMQ初体验-31.公布/订阅模式进阶-黑盒的高速订阅者

2012-10-08 
zeroMQ初体验-31.发布/订阅模式进阶-黑盒的高速订阅者作为发布/订阅模式的一个常用场景,大数据量的组播是

zeroMQ初体验-31.发布/订阅模式进阶-黑盒的高速订阅者
作为发布/订阅模式的一个常用场景,大数据量的组播是有必要的。虽然100k/s的数度对于zeromq实在稀松平常,不过,谁会介意更快呢。

模型图:


提高效率的核心在于充分利用硬件资源,比如多核的cpu,多线程即为此而生(可惜python没有)。
于是,上图的线程级模型就会变成这样:


需要注意的:
这里需要两个i/0线程两张网卡(俩线程各用其一)这俩还得各自独占一个cpu核,其他线程(worker)根据核数确定数量,并且同时都对应两个i/o线程做连接。线程数最好不要大于cpu核数,不然,适得其反。

额,竟然没有代码,单薄了些~

(未完待续)

热点排行